In a small village of Rajasthan, an 80-year-old man has preserved hundreds of traditional items used by his ancestors and turned his home into a living museum.
This inspiring story shows how Baba Ji has carefully protected tools, camel equipment, farming instruments, weighing scales, and handmade household items used by past generations. These artifacts represent a time when life was simple, self-sufficient, and deeply connected to nature.
Despite his age, Baba Ji remains energetic, practices devotion every morning at 4 AM, and continues to demonstrate the traditional knowledge passed down through generations.
